Smokey Bones Daily Specials Menu With Prices

The Smokey Bones daily specials menu with prices is designed to give you a different barbecue experience every day of the week. From half-price racks of ribs to discounted burgers, each special is tied to a specific day. Below is the full breakdown.

Monday: Half-Price Rack Of Ribs

Monday is all about ribs. You can get a full rack of Smokey Bones’ signature smoked ribs for half the regular price. This is one of the most popular deals of the week.

  • Regular price for a full rack: $24.99
  • Monday special price: $12.49
  • Available for dine-in and takeout
  • Choose from original, sweet & smoky, or spicy BBQ sauce

Pro tip: Order the rib tips if you want extra meaty pieces. They are often less busy on Monday evenings, so you can grab a table quickly.

Tuesday: $5 Burger Night

Tuesday brings a classic burger deal. You can get any of Smokey Bones’ hand-pressed burgers for just $5. This includes the classic cheeseburger, bacon burger, and the smokehouse burger.

  • Classic cheeseburger: $5.00
  • Bacon cheeseburger: $5.00
  • Smokehouse burger (with pulled pork on top): $5.00
  • Add fries for $2.00 extra

Note: The burger special does not include toppings like avocado or extra cheese. Those cost a little more. But for a basic burger, it is a steal.

Wednesday: Wing Wednesday

Wings are the star on Wednesday. Smokey Bones offers bone-in and boneless wings at a discounted price. You can choose from a variety of sauces, including buffalo, honey garlic, and mango habanero.

  • 10 bone-in wings: $8.99 (regularly $12.99)
  • 10 boneless wings: $7.99 (regularly $10.99)
  • 20 bone-in wings: $15.99
  • 20 boneless wings: $13.99

Pair your wings with a side of ranch or blue cheese. The blue cheese is house-made and worth trying.

Thursday: Smokehouse Thursday

Thursday is for the big eaters. The Smokehouse Thursday special features a combination platter with brisket, pulled pork, and a choice of two sides. It is a filling meal at a reduced price.

  • Smokehouse platter: $14.99 (regularly $19.99)
  • Includes 6 oz brisket and 6 oz pulled pork
  • Choose two sides: coleslaw, baked beans, mac and cheese, or fries
  • Add cornbread for $1.50

This is a good day to try the brisket if you have not had it before. It is smoked for 14 hours and comes out tender.

Friday: Fish Fry Friday

Friday brings a seafood option. The Fish Fry Friday special includes beer-battered cod fillets served with fries and coleslaw. It is a lighter alternative to the heavy barbecue.

  • Fish fry platter: $11.99 (regularly $15.99)
  • Includes three cod fillets
  • Served with fries and coleslaw
  • Add a second piece of fish for $3.00

Note: The fish fry is only available after 4 PM on Friday. Lunch hours do not include this special.

Saturday & Sunday: Weekend Specials

Weekends at Smokey Bones have a different vibe. Saturday and Sunday feature a brunch menu from 10 AM to 2 PM, plus a few all-day deals.

  • Saturday: $10 off any purchase of $30 or more (dine-in only)
  • Sunday: Kids eat free with the purchase of an adult entree (limit two kids per adult)
  • Brunch specials: Biscuits and gravy ($7.99), breakfast burrito ($9.99), and smoked brisket hash ($11.99)

Sunday is a great day for families. The kids menu includes chicken tenders, mac and cheese, and mini burgers.

Combine Specials With Loyalty Rewards

Smokey Bones has a loyalty program called Bones Rewards. You earn points for every dollar spent. These points can be redeemed for free food or discounts.

  • Sign up online or in the app
  • Earn 10 points per dollar spent
  • 500 points = $5 off
  • 1,000 points = $10 off
  • Stack points with daily specials for extra savings

What To Drink With Your Special

Smokey Bones has a full bar with beer, cocktails, and soft drinks. Some drinks are also discounted during the week.

  • Monday: $3 domestic beers (bottles)
  • Tuesday: $4 margaritas
  • Wednesday: $5 wine glasses
  • Thursday: $2 off craft beers
  • Friday: $6 specialty cocktails

If you are not drinking alcohol, the house-made lemonade and sweet tea are good choices. They are refillable for dine-in customers.
